Went to Kmart to a washer, mind you I did have the money in bank to buy it, after talking to them with the why not lease it signs all we discussed it. So we picked out washer and went to front desk while they got it ready and they esplained to us it was going Ibe like rent a center type. Ok since washer was on sale I could take a couple extra payments instead of draining checking accountant.

Thinking this would be paid off in November I called them in Decenmber to ask why still taking payment out of checking acct. they said it was not paid off yet we could buy it out right for another $300 and some odd dollars well I am still thinking it is like rent a center well couple mor months it will be paid and it is Holidays I am running low on money.

Now it is almost May I call them they finally explain they system I am still leasing I have not bought it out right I had to pay the $300 and some odd dollars to pay it off and get out of lease. So to purchase a washer for little over $500 with out taxes I have paid for months thinking it will be mine with this payment plan.

Kmart prints up a ontract as you stand n wait for them to be done that is like a book and real small print you can't read if you do not have glasses and they fail to explain this system in full. I paid for almost a year Buyer beware this is a scam.
